223671-81-6,223673-35-6,22367-76-6,223677-90-5,223678-23-7,223680-42-0 Supplier | CHEMBETA.COM
CMO CDMO service. CHEMBETA.COM supply 223671-81-6,223673-35-6,22367-76-6,223677-90-5,223678-23-7,223680-42-0 and related compounds.
223677-90-5 223673-35-6 223671-81-6 223680-42-0 223678-23-7 22367-76-6